What's you most unusual plant that you grow???

OK, folks....whats the most unusual plant that you are growing here in the UK?? Is it a non-native/tropical/difficult/expensive plant etc etc. Have you bought it as a plant/grown from seed/cutting etc etc?

My most unusual are Desert Roses/Adenium Obesums that I am growing from seed. I have tried two batches and I can get them to germinate, but I find they are difficult to keep growing during the winter when they must be kept fairly dry especially if they go dormant. This 2nd batch has been more sucessful and I now have 5 nice young 14mth old plants. Hopefully I will get them to flower. They like lots of light and heat so I realise I will be lucky to keep them thriving. I saw my first one in Bangkok a few years ago and fell in love with them as they can grow huge swollen caudexes. I have only ever seen them for sale once in the UK and they were pricey. I also grow plumerias, strelitzia, several types of palms, echiums, various orchids, and far too many other plants, or so my d/h keeps reminding me.
